Details
A vulnerability classified as problematic has been found in Linux Kernel up to 2.5 (Operating System). This affects the function rose_rt_ioctl of the file rose_route.c. The manipulation of the argument ndigis with an unknown input leads to a access control vulnerability. CWE is classifying the issue as CWE-264. This is going to have an impact on integrity. The summary by CVE is:
The rose_rt_ioctl function in rose_route.c for Radionet Open Source Environment (ROSE) in Linux 2.6 kernels before 2.6.12, and 2.4 before 2.4.29, does not properly verify the ndigis argument for a new route, which allows attackers to trigger array out-of-bounds errors with a large number of digipeats.
The bug was discovered 03/18/2005. The weakness was presented 10/20/2005 by ryan with Coverity (Website). The advisory is shared at lkml.org. This vulnerability is uniquely identified as CVE-2005-3273 since 10/20/2005. The exploitability is told to be easy. It is possible to initiate the attack remotely. No form of authentication is needed for exploitation. Technical details are known, but no exploit is available. MITRE ATT&CK project uses the attack technique T1068 for this issue.
The vulnerability was handled as a non-public zero-day exploit for at least 194 days. During that time the estimated underground price was around $5k-$25k. The vulnerability scanner Nessus provides a plugin with the ID 21849 (CentOS 3 : kernel (CESA-2005:663)), which helps to determine the existence of the flaw in a target environment. It is assigned to the family CentOS Local Security Checks and running in the context l. The commercial vulnerability scanner Qualys is able to test this issue with plugin 117692 (CentOS Security Update for Kernel (CESA-2006:0579)).
Upgrading to version 2.6 eliminates this vulnerability. A possible mitigation has been published before and not just after the disclosure of the vulnerability.
